返回顶部
首页 > 资讯 > 精选 >负载均衡算法Round Robin是如何工作的
  • 722
分享到

负载均衡算法Round Robin是如何工作的

负载均衡 2024-04-17 16:04:50 722人浏览 泡泡鱼
摘要

Round Robin负载均衡算法是一种简单而常用的算法。它将所有的请求依次分配给每个服务器,直到所有的服务器都被轮询到一次,然后再

Round Robin负载均衡算法是一种简单而常用的算法。它将所有的请求依次分配给每个服务器,直到所有的服务器都被轮询到一次,然后再从头开始轮询。这样做的好处是每台服务器都能够平均地分担负载,避免出现单台服务器负载过重的情况。

具体工作流程如下:

  1. 将所有可用的服务器按顺序排列,形成一个服务器列表。
  2. 当有新的请求到达负载均衡器时,负载均衡器会依次将请求分配给列表中的每台服务器。
  3. 当所有服务器都被轮询一遍后,负载均衡器会重新从第一台服务器开始轮询,直到所有请求都被处理完。

需要注意的是,Round Robin负载均衡算法并不考虑服务器的负载情况,只是简单地将请求平均分配给每台服务器。因此,在一些情况下可能会出现某些服务器负载过重的情况。为了解决这个问题,可以采用其他负载均衡算法,如加权轮询或基于响应时间的负载均衡算法。

--结束END--

本文标题: 负载均衡算法Round Robin是如何工作的

本文链接: https://lsjlt.com/news/605187.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• 负载均衡算法Round Robin是如何工作的
    Round Robin负载均衡算法是一种简单而常用的算法。它将所有的请求依次分配给每个服务器,直到所有的服务器都被轮询到一次,然后再...
    99+
    2024-04-17
    负载均衡
  • 负载均衡算法Least Connections是如何工作的
    Least Connections(最小连接)负载均衡算法是一种基于实时观察服务器连接数来分配请求的算法。其工作原理如下: 当一次...
    99+
    2024-04-17
    负载均衡
  • 了解Nginx负载均衡算法fair的工作原理
    引言:在高并发场景下,单个服务器可能无法满足用户的请求。为了提高服务器的处理能力和稳定性,常常会使用负载均衡技术。Nginx作为一款高性能的Web服务器和反向代理服务器,其内置的负载均衡模块提供了多种算法供选择。其中"fair"算法是一种基...
    99+
    2023-10-21
    nginx 负载均衡 fair算法
  • 负载均衡器的缓存机制是如何工作的
    负载均衡器的缓存机制通常工作如下: 当客户端发送请求时,负载均衡器会首先检查缓存中是否已经有对应的响应数据。 如果缓存中有数据且未...
    99+
    2024-04-17
    负载均衡
  • 负载均衡slb的工作原理是什么
    负载均衡(SLB)是一种网络技术,通过将网络流量分发到多台服务器上,以达到提高性能、可靠性和可伸缩性的目的。其工作原理如下: 客...
    99+
    2024-04-09
    负载均衡SLB 负载均衡
  • 动态负载均衡算法是什么
    动态负载均衡算法是一种根据实时负载情况来动态调整服务器负载分配的算法。在动态负载均衡算法中,服务器根据自身的负载情况和其他服务器的负...
    99+
    2023-09-02
    动态负载均衡 负载均衡
  • 负载均衡调度算法是什么
    负载均衡调度算法是一种用于分配请求到多个服务器的算法,以实现在不同服务器之间平衡负载的目的。负载均衡调度算法根据不同的策略和条件来选...
    99+
    2023-09-02
    负载均衡
  • 负载均衡的算法有哪些
    负载均衡的算法有:轮询法:Round Robin,适合用于服务器硬件条件基本都相同的情况加权轮询法:Weight Robin随机法:Random加权随机法:Weight Random最小连接法:Least Connections源地址哈希法...
    99+
    2024-04-02
  • 负载均衡的作用是什么
    负载均衡的作用:能够解决网络拥堵的问题。提高了用户体验感。能够是服务器响应速度更快。提高服务器及其他资源的利用效率。通过重新分配系统负载,使各服务器间负载达到相对均衡。...
    99+
    2024-04-02
  • Java 负载均衡算法作用详细解析
    目录前言轮询算法随机算法加权随机算法加权轮询算法源地址hash算法最小请求数算法前言 负载均衡在Java领域中有着广泛深入的应用,不管是大名鼎鼎的nginx,还是微服务治理组件如du...
    99+
    2024-04-02
  • 负载均衡器的作用是什么
    负载均衡器的作用:1、拥有提供服务一致性的功能;2、能够清理服务集群中某个节点无法成功处理请求时的请求失败信息,并将该节点发往其他节点上去;3、具有统计计量的功能,从而观察各阶段各种流量流动来适当调整系统性能。具体内容如下:负载均衡器顾名思...
    99+
    2024-04-02
  • springcloud负载均衡的作用是什么
    Spring Cloud负载均衡的作用是帮助应用程序在多个服务提供者之间分配负载,以提高系统的可扩展性和可靠性。具体来说,Sprin...
    99+
    2023-09-01
    springcloud 负载均衡
  • nginx负载均衡算法及原理是什么
    Nginx负载均衡算法及原理主要涉及以下几个方面:1. 轮询(Round Robin)算法:Nginx默认采用的是轮询算法,即将请求...
    99+
    2023-10-08
    nginx
  • 常见的负载均衡算法有哪些
    常见的负载均衡算法有:1、轮询法Round Robin,将请求按顺序轮流分配到后台服务器上,从而均衡的对待每一台服务器;2、随机法,通过系统随机函数,根据后台服务器列表的大小值来随机选取其中一台进行访问;3、源地址哈希法,主要是根据服务消费...
    99+
    2024-04-02
  • 常用负载均衡的算法有哪些
    常用的负载均衡算法包括:1. 轮询(Round Robin)算法:按照请求的顺序依次分配给后端服务器,每个服务器依次处理一个请求,然...
    99+
    2023-09-01
    负载均衡
  • 网络负载均衡的作用是什么
    网络负载均衡的作用是:1、增加吞吐量,加强网络数据处理能力,解决网络拥塞问题;2、提高网络的灵活性与可用性,为用户提供更好的访问质量;3、能够提高服务器响应速度;4、提高服务器及其他资源的利用效率;5、在高并发情况下,保证服务不中断,使服务...
    99+
    2024-04-02
  • 应用负载均衡的作用是什么
    应用负载均衡的作用是将请求分配到多个服务器上,以平衡服务器的负载,提高应用的性能和可靠性。具体作用包括:1. 提高性能:负载均衡将请...
    99+
    2023-09-07
    负载均衡
  • 链路负载均衡的作用是什么
    链路负载均衡的作用是将网络流量均匀地分布到多条链路上,以实现链路的高可用性和提高网络性能。它可以根据不同的负载均衡策略,将流量分配到...
    99+
    2023-09-07
    负载均衡
  • Apache的负载均衡如何实现
    Apache的负载均衡可以通过以下几种常见的方式来实现: 使用Apache的内置模块mod_proxy和mod_proxy_balancer来实现负载均衡。mod_proxy_balancer模块可以将请求分发到多个后端服务器上,实现负...
    99+
    2024-07-05
    apache
  • LVS负载均衡(LVS简介、三种工作模式、十种调度算法)
    LVS(Linux Virtual Server)是一个高性能、可扩展的负载均衡器,用于分发网络流量到多个服务器上,提高系统的可用性...
    99+
    2023-09-20
    LVS负载均衡
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作